Output 6b17d65528bb2ae741e6d827761dcb7e82643f63dd85523fd6a3003abd6846fc:3

value
29392
script pubkey
OP_0 OP_PUSHBYTES_20 b8709aaa0921166238c09bd5010e6fd8f20cae67
address
bc1qhpcf42sfyytxywxqn02szrn0mreqetn8khu7cy
transaction
6b17d65528bb2ae741e6d827761dcb7e82643f63dd85523fd6a3003abd6846fc
confirmations
2050
spent
true